What You'll Do:

  • Operate equipment and follow all steps of the cheesemaking process (pasteurizing, setting, cutting, cooking, draining, pressing, brining)

  • Grade and record milk and cheese quality (pH, temperature, moisture, salt levels)

  • Unload milk from tankers, take samples, test quality, and approve/reject loads per Ontario regulations

  • Run, clean, and sanitize vats, pumps, silos, and production equipment

  • Follow food safety and hygiene rules (GMPs, HACCP, allergen controls, labeling)

  • Keep accurate records and production paperwork

  • Support continuous improvement (efficiency, yields, waste reduction) and help train assistants
